Release from your tax debt

If payment of your tax debt would cause you serious hardship, contact us immediately on 13 11 42 to discuss your circumstances. You may be able to apply for a release from your tax debt.

Serious hardship is when payment of the debt would leave you unable to provide food, accommodation, clothing, medical treatment, education or other necessities for yourself or your family, or other people you're responsible for.

We're committed to understanding your situation and individual circumstances and will help you to deal with your outstanding liabilities, where possible.

Depending on your circumstances we may be able release you from some or all of the debt.

Attention icon

Not all requests for release are granted.
